Go ahead and change the rest of them to do the same. Work fast with our official CLI. This article is an extract from our Premium library. Let’s set up a new Expo project using expo-cli: It will then ask you to choose a template. This will automatically run the iOS Simulator even if it’s not opened. React Native Swipe Cards Lastly, it will ask you to press y to install dependencies with yarn or n to install dependencies with npm. It adds a compatibility layer around @oblador/react-native-vector-icons to work with the Expo asset system. You can always update your selection by clicking Cookie Preferences at the bottom of the page. Tinder like React Native Dating Backend App for iOS & Android. Let your users create … We need to change the implementation of HomeStack in the MainTabNavigator.js folder to incorporate with the new TabBarIcon component’s Icon prop. Firstly, go into constants/Pics.js and add the following bit at the end: These are the images we’ll need in the Top Picks screen. Next, create a utils/shuffleArray.js file and paste the following into it: This makes sure our array is randomized every time. For this tutorial, you need a basic knowledge of React Native and some familiarity with Expo. All pages and components are set. Download this React Native starter kit to create your own Tinder Clone in React Native. imageContainer has a width and a height. If nothing happens, download the GitHub extension for Visual Studio and try again. activeOpacity is a number passed to control opacity on pressing the Tile, which is optional, but the default value is 0.2, which makes it look transparent on press, so we pass a value close to 1 to keep it opaque. Click here, Most effective day trading products! The render method contains the usual SafeAreaView, Text, View, and our custom Social component—with a little bit of styling which we’ve already covered above. We’ll then learn about a UI framework called React Native Elements, which makes styling React Native apps easy. download the GitHub extension for Visual Studio. We could also create everything completely from scratch without using any UI library, but it would require us to write a lot of code—mostly styling. This React Native app is made by expert UI developers to match the Tinder App UI, so you can start your own dating app or a similar app with these functionalities. It’s also open source and backed by a community of awesome developers. Made using Canva(www.canva.com)So I recently completed a course on React Native with on Coursera and wanted to put my new skills to some good use. Notice every time we call shuffleArray to randomize our array. Traffic, Traffic, And More Traffic. If you don’t have yarn already installed, install it from here. Instagram mobile app clone using React Native. This is a great starting point for dating app development as more than half the work is done here. 4 screens are availables : Explore, Matches, Messages and Profile. The project aims to provide a dedicated box like platform for it's users where they can have dedicated spaces for their friends, The tool to help you to answer where should I have lunch, Dark Mode Instagram Clone With React-Native, An open source Social Media platform with react native, A material design UI slider for React Native, A simple component that allows you to add fade effect in ScrollView at both ends. Be sure, you have installed all dependencies and applications to run React Native project on your computer : Getting Started with React Native. Run the Tinder Clone on Android & iOS. Create Messages.js in the constants/ folder and paste in the following: Next, create MessagesScreen.js in the components/ folder and paste in the following: We take the dummy data Messages and map over it and put it in a ListItem exported from react-native-elements. The initial setup has already installed react-navigation for us. It’s also open source and backed by a community of awesome developers. First, create a utils/randomNo.js file and paste in the following: The function randomNo returns a random number between min and max. Lunch picker is the tool you’ll turn to to answer this question. You can get a list of all the properties in the styling cheatsheet. // This is the font that we're using for our tab bar, // This is the font we're using for our tab bar, // In this case, you might want to report the error to your error, // found from https://stackoverflow.com/a/50318831/6141587, // found at https://stackoverflow.com/a/46545530/6141587, 'How about we go for a coffee on Sunday? Use them in your next dating app. We’ll also be hiding our StatusBar in App.js with this: We’ll also replace the assets used in App.js: The App.js file should now look like this: We also need to link all of the above screens—TopPicksScreen.js, ProfileScreen.js and MessagesScreen.js—inside screens/ in MainTabNavigator.js inside the navigation/ folder, as shown in the following flowchart: Also add the following in MainTabNavigator.js: The above code creates three stack navigators—TopPicksStack, MessagesStack and ProfileStack. We also need overflow: hidden to make it work. Online Opportunities When installation is complete, run with version of your choice : Feel free to contribute on this repository. GitHub is home to over 50 million developers working together to host and review code, manage projects, and build software together. they're used to log you in. they're used to gather information about the pages you visit and how many clicks you need to accomplish a task. Tinder Clone is one of the solutions to start the business instantly. It currently looks like this: Remove references to LinksStack and SettingsStack completely, because we don’t need these screens in our app. We’ve successfully cloned a Tinder UI with a little bit of custom styling and with a lot of help from React Native Elements. Work fast with our official CLI. The Tile component has some additional properties. We can completely delete LinksScreen.js and SettingsScreen.js from the screens/ folder. You also need to have a basic knowledge of styles in React Native. Change the HomeStack variable implementation to this: The only change here is the addition of Icon={Icon.MaterialCommunityIcons}, since we changed the implementation of TabBarIcon to accept the icon source so we can use different types of icons from different providers. You'll find some components like Card Component to pass props and variant. If you want to learn how to build an app like Tinder, from scratch, in React Native, follow this step by step tutorial, created by Instamobile on React Native Swipe Cards. We’ll also be making use of a lot of dummy data to make our app. Then we loop through all the images we just added in constants/Pics.js and display them using the Tile component. Work at Home Learn more. All from our global community of web developers. Now create a constants/Pics.js file and paste in the following: This contains all the images required for our app. All you need here is to integrate your back-end and change the logics.This app has many features common with … We use optional third-party analytics cookies to understand how you use GitHub.com so we can build better products. If it’s not installed already, then go ahead and install it: To make sure we’re on the same page, these are the versions used in this tutorial: Make sure to update expo-cli if you haven’t updated in a while, since expo releases are quickly out of date. Styles in React Native are basically an abstraction similar to that of CSS, with just a few differences. Use UI frameworks to write less code and ship faster. Hence, we’re going to install v1.5.25: Now go into the HomeScreen.js file and paste the following: Now our cards are swipable, and our home screen looks like this: Try swiping now, and it should work as follows: If you want to learn how to make these kinds of Tinder Swipe animations, you should check out Varun Nath’s Tinder Swipe Series on YouTube. Implement your own Tinder Clone by using the most powerful, dynamic, highly modular and customizable React Native Dating Templates. This starter kit is supported with backend. The bottom tab navigation also works by default because we chose tabs in the second step of expo init. The title and caption are placed in center by default, but we’ve moved them to the bottom left with position:'absolute'. Click here, Order Your NanoTowels Today And Together, Let's Make A Difference, WJR Business Beat with Jeff Sloan: New Businesses Are Being Started Amid Pandemic (Episode 121), Making Business Connections in the Digital Age: Tips for Networking Offline, Looking at an Online School Through a Web Designer’s Eyes, Ways Web Designers Give Away Their Time (Without Realizing It), Affiliate Marketing Training Guides /eBooks, Best Body Detoxification Guides & reviews. I appreciate the trust you have placed in me!! Display actions buttons (Like, Dislike, ...). We’re going to build something that looks like this: If you just want to clone the repo, the whole code can be found on GitHub. Fullstack Tinder app clone made with React/Ts/Nest - MarcinMiler/tinder-clone The Principles of Beautiful Web Design, 4th Edition. We’ve already created a project named expo-tinder. We’re going to use a Tile component from react-native-elements to display our User Card. The post Cloning Tinder Using React Native Elements and Expo appeared first on SitePoint. Use free templates and starters to get up and running within hours. From advice for getting in shape to healthy cooking recipes and dating advice, ClickBank delivers digital lifestyle products to customers in 190 countries. Remember, SafeAreaView should always be set up on screen components or any content in them, and not wrap entire navigators. For that, we need to change App.js by adding the following: These font types are used at some points in our application. To get rid of it, we need to add headerMode: 'none' in the createStackNavigator config. Note that the emulator must be installed and started already before typing a. Front-end clone of the Tinder app with react native. Offers Mobile App, Admin Dashboard, API Server with necessary features like profile match, chat, tinder like swipe & lots more. This free React Native starter kit contains beautiful components inspired by Tinder UI. You can find it here on GitHub. You can get a list of all the properties in the styling cheatsheet. Otherwise it will throw an error in the terminal. The static property navigationOptions lets us add our own label and icon to the bottom tab. Now these icons need to be loaded first. 4 screens are availables : Explore, Matches, Messages and Profile. Now that our navigation is taken care of, we can start working on the layout. Coupon not valid for the product(s) in cart. If nothing happens, download GitHub Desktop and try again. You’ll also need the Expo client installed on your mobile device or a compatible simulator installed on your computer. Then it will ask you to name the project. This means a lot to me and keeps me going! React Native Elements is a cross-platform UI Toolkit for React Native with consistent design across Android, iOS and Web. This backend app is built using NativeBase, React Navigation, GraphQL, Apollo Client. We’re going to be using a UI toolkit called React Native Elements, so go ahead and install it: Before starting anything, make sure to copy the assets/ directory from the GitHub repo entirely for dummy images. Making pixel-perfect layouts on mobile is hard. Perfect to start an Tinder Clone app.

Steven Crowder Health, Is Ferb Autistic, Atc Barge Strappings, Jackson Brundage Height 2020, 小田茜 現在 画像, Nitrogen Blanket Oil Filled Transformers, Bogoroditse Devo Ttbb Pdf, How Do You Add A Second Player On Just Dance 2020, Que Significa Carlos David, Trek Serial Number Wtu, How To Connect Rockband Guitar To Wii, Widepeepohappy Twitch Emote, Mike Hall Rust Bros Family, Is Robert Noah Still Alive, Endlers Livebearers Petsmart, Four Spirits Statue, Must Play Retro Games, Fallen God Meaning, Versace N95 Mask, Mark Ramsey Moonshiners,